About The Position

Commercial Foodservice Equipment Maintenance Technician A-1 Restaurant is looking for an experienced Food Equipment Repair Technician. You will be responsible for diagnosis and troubleshooting of systems, operation, maintenance and repair of all makes and models of commercial food equipment. We can promise a new problem will need to be addressed in every service call. Qualified Applicants will have experience in troubleshooting and/or installing the following items but no limited to: Slicers, Ovens, Steamers, Microwaves, Warmers, Heat Elements, Mixers, Fryers, Grills, Beverage Dispensers, Crescor Toasters

Requirements

  • High School Diploma or GED Required
  • Three to Five years experience in installation, maintenance, troubleshooting and correcting diverse commercial food equipment service issues.
  • Basic computer and internet skills/ Smart Phone Capabilities
  • Be available to work nights or weekends, on a rotating basis, to service emergency needs of our customers.
  • The ability to lift up to 50 pounds; be able to push, pull, carry or maneuver heavier items (with additional manpower or appropriate devices) carry ladders; work from heights, and work in small crawl spaces
  • Multi-tasking and good time management skills
  • Valid Drivers license and clean driving record
  • Must be able to pass any and all drug tests required by A-1 Services
  • Maintain accurate time records and send to payroll when required

Responsibilities

  • Troubleshoots and repairs commercial kitchen equipment.
  • Inspects the commercial kitchen equipment and their related components to ensure safe operation.
  • Communicates with customer and branch office regarding status of repairs to ensure schedule is maintained and delays are properly communicated with customers.
  • Completes service tickets according to procedures.
  • Performs manual tasks such as: bending, reaching, standing, lifting/carrying up to 50 lbs., or maneuvering heavier items with additional manpower or appropriate devices.
  • Tracks truck stock to ensure needed parts are stocked on vehicle.
  • Sustains service vehicle, tools, and uniforms to Tech24 standards.
  • Sets a positive example for less experienced and/or new technicians by being a Company advocate.
  • Follows all company policies and procedures, particularly regarding safety.
